Land of the Serengeti, the Great Migration, and Africa’s Highest Peak

Tanzania is where the rhythm of nature plays loud and clear—a land of epic landscapes, endless skies, and thundering hooves. This is where the Great Migration unfolds across the golden plains of the Serengeti, where lion prides stalk through grasses lit by dawn, and where life moves in timeless patterns shaped by instinct and survival. At the heart of it all is a sense of space and scale that leaves you breathless.

To the north lies the gorongoro Crater—an ancient volcanic caldera that shelters one of the densest concentrations of wildlife in Africa. Nearby, Tarangire is home to giant baobabs and vast elephant herds, while Lake Manyara’s forested shores bring tree-climbing lions and playful troops of baboons. For those seeking the rare and remote, Tanzania’s southern and western parks—Ruaha and Mahale Mountains—offer wild, off-the-beaten-path encounters where few others go.

Beyond the safari, Tanzania reveals yet another world: the warm, spice-scented shores of Zanzibar. Here, Swahili culture meets barefoot luxury, and turquoise waters lap gently at white sand beaches. Where to Go in Tanzania

Serengeti National Park

One of the most iconic wildlife destinations on Earth, the Serengeti is the stage for the Great Migration and home to Africa’s most storied predators. Its golden plains, endless skies, and timeless rhythm define the heart of the safari experience.

Grumeti Reserve

Part of the greater Serengeti ecosystem, this private reserve offers exclusive access to the migration and a high level of privacy. With strict conservation controls and luxury camps, it’s safari at its most refined and emote.

Ngorongoro Crater

An ancient volcanic caldera teeming with wildlife, Ngorongoro offers dramatic cenery and year-round game viewing. Descend into this natural amphitheater for one of Africa’s most unique and unforgettable safari days.

Tarangire National Park

Known for its towering baobabs and large elephant herds, Tarangire is a quiet gem with seasonal wetlands and ancient migratory routes. A great addition to the Northern Circuit for those seeking diversity and fewer crowds.

Lake Manyara National Park

A compact park rich in biodiversity, Manyara is known for its tree-climbing lions, birdlife, and flamingo-filled lake. Scenic and accessible, it’s an ideal soft start or finish to a Northern Tanzania safari.

Ruaha National Park

Vast, untamed, and often overlooked, Ruaha is a dream for seasoned safari-goers. Expect dramatic landscapes, predator-rich territories, and an unfiltered sense of wilderness in southern Tanzania.

Mahale Mountains National Park

Accessible only by boat, Mahale is one of Africa’s most magical places—where you can track wild chimpanzees through tropical forests by day and relax on a white sand beach by evening. Wild, spiritual, and deeply moving.

Zanzibar

An archipelago of white-sand beaches, spice markets, and Swahili heritage, Zanzibar is the perfect post-safari retreat. Whether you’re diving, sailing, or simply unwinding, it offers a slower rhythm and soul-soothing calm.

Arusha

Tanzania’s safari hub and cultural gateway, Arusha is where many journeys begin. Nestled at the foot of Mount Meru, it’s a vibrant town with bustling markets, coffee farms, and the perfect place to rest before heading into the wild.
